The Role of Smart Manufacturing in Advancing the Pipe Insulation Market
In today’s industrial and commercial world, efficient energy management is no longer just a target — it’s an operational necessity. Among the many technologies enabling this shift, pipe insulation stands out as a fundamental yet often overlooked component that delivers significant energy savings. Whether in power plants, chemical facilities, or residential buildings, insulation ensures that hot or cold fluids maintain their temperature as they move through networks of pipes. This simple yet powerful function supports both sustainability and profitability, making insulation a critical factor in modern infrastructure.
The Pipe Insulation Market is evolving rapidly as industries embrace green technologies. Traditional materials such as fiberglass and polyurethane are being enhanced with innovative composites and nano-insulation materials to achieve higher thermal resistance and durability. The growing focus on net-zero buildings, industrial decarbonization, and energy-efficient manufacturing has accelerated the adoption of advanced insulation systems worldwide. Governments in regions such as Europe and North America are offering incentives for retrofitting existing facilities with better insulation, while emerging economies are integrating insulation standards into new construction codes.
Industrial demand for high-performance insulation is driven by several factors. Energy-intensive sectors like oil & gas, chemical manufacturing, and food processing rely on consistent temperature maintenance to ensure product quality and safety. In these industries, even minor thermal fluctuations can lead to energy waste and equipment inefficiencies. This awareness has prompted companies to invest in solutions that enhance long-term operational efficiency and minimize environmental impact. Additionally, urbanization and the expansion of district heating and cooling networks in developing countries have opened new growth opportunities for insulation suppliers.
The competitive landscape is also shifting as manufacturers innovate toward sustainability. Recyclable and bio-based insulation products are gaining momentum, appealing to industries focused on reducing carbon footprints. Smart insulation systems equipped with sensors are beginning to emerge, allowing for predictive maintenance and real-time performance tracking.
